From ede076ae7af87b38d5a3cbdab10d3d2c1bbbfa25 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Maor Dickman Date: Wed, 8 Feb 2023 17:44:06 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] net/mlx5: Geneve, Fix handling of Geneve object id as error code [ Upstream commit cf50115be971ab03e94c861f6fe45081be6e0694 ] On success, mlx5_geneve_tlv_option_create returns non negative Geneve object id. In case the object id is positive value the caller functions will handle it as an error (non zero) and will fail to offload the Geneve rule. Fix this by changing caller function ,mlx5_geneve_tlv_option_add, to return 0 in case valid non negative object id was provided.
